+# machinectl(1) completion -*- shell-script -*-
+#
+# This file is part of systemd.
+#
+# Copyright 2014 Thomas H.P. Andersen
+#
+# systemd is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ify it
+# under the terms of the GNU Lesser General Public License as published by
+# the Free Software Foundation; either version 2.1 of the License, or
+# (at your option) any later version.
+#
+# systemd is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, but
+# W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
+# M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the GNU
+# General Public License for more details.
+#
+# You should have received a copy of the GNU Lesser General Public License
+# along with systemd; If not, see <http://www.gnu.org/licenses/>.
+
+__contains_word() {
+ local w word=$1; shift
+ for w in "$@"; do
+ [[ $w = "$word" ]] && return
+ done
+}
+
+__get_machines() {
+ local a b
+ machinectl list --no-legend --no-pager | { while read a b; do echo " $a"; done; };
+}
+
+_machinectl() {
+ local cur=${COMP_WORDS[COMP_CWORD]} prev=${COMP_WORDS[COMP_CWORD-1]}
+ local i verb comps
+
+ local -A OPTS=(
+ [STANDALONE]='--all -a --full --help -h --no-ask-password --no-legend --no-pager --version'
+ [ARG]='--host -H --kill-who -M --machine --property -p --signal -s'
+ )
+
+ local -A VERBS=(
+ [STANDALONE]='list'
+ [MACHINES]='status show terminate kill reboot login'
+ )
+
+ _init_completion || return
+
+ for ((i=0; i <= COMP_CWORD; i++)); do
+ if __contains_word "${COMP_WORDS[i]}" ${VERBS[*]} &&
+ ! __contains_word "${COMP_WORDS[i-1]}" ${OPTS[ARG]}; then
+ verb=${COMP_WORDS[i]}
+ break
+ fi
+ done
+
+ if __contains_word "$prev" ${OPTS[ARG]}; then
+ case $prev in
+ --signal|-s)
+ comps=$(compgen -A signal)
+ ;;
+ --kill-who)
+ comps='all leader'
+ ;;
+ --host|-H)
+ comps=$(compgen -A hostname)
+ ;;
+ --machine|-M)
+ comps=$( __get_machines )
+ ;;
+ --property|-p)
+ comps=''
+ ;;
+ esac
+ COMPREPLY=( $(compgen -W '$comps' -- "$cur") )
+ return 0
+ fi
+
+ if [[ "$cur" = -* ]]; then
+ COMPREPLY=( $(compgen -W '${OPTS[*]}' -- "$cur") )
+ return 0
+ fi
+
+ if [[ -z $verb ]]; then
+ comps=${VERBS[*]}
+
+ elif __contains_word "$verb" ${VERBS[STANDALONE]}; then
+ comps=''
+
+ elif __contains_word "$verb" ${VERBS[MACHINES]}; then
+ comps=$( __get_machines )
+ fi
+
+ COMPREPLY=( $(compgen -W '$comps' -- "$cur") )
+ return 0
+}
+
+complete -F _machinectl machinectl
